How to fill out professional disclosure statement for

How to fill out professional disclosure statement for
01
Start by including your full name and contact information at the top of the document.
02
Include a brief summary of your education and professional background.
03
Clearly outline your areas of expertise and specializations.
04
Disclose any relevant professional affiliations or memberships.
05
Include information about your licensing and certification credentials.
06
Provide details about your professional experience and any relevant trainings or workshops attended.
07
Include a section on your professional ethics and code of conduct.
08
Include a statement about confidentiality and privacy practices.
09
Include information on how clients can contact you and schedule appointments.
10
Review the document for accuracy and completeness before sharing it with clients.
Who needs professional disclosure statement for?
01
Professional disclosure statements are typically needed by therapists, counselors, psychologists, social workers, lawyers, financial advisors, and other professionals who provide services to clients.
02
It helps clients understand the background, qualifications, and professional practices of the service provider before engaging in services.

What is professional disclosure statement for?
The professional disclosure statement is a document that discloses a professional's qualifications, experience, and potential conflicts of interest.
Who is required to file professional disclosure statement for?
Professionals such as attorneys, doctors, and financial advisors are typically required to file a professional disclosure statement.
How to fill out professional disclosure statement for?
The professional disclosure statement can usually be filled out online or in a physical form provided by the relevant licensing or regulatory body.
What is the purpose of professional disclosure statement for?
The purpose of the professional disclosure statement is to provide transparency and allow clients or patients to make informed decisions when hiring a professional.
What information must be reported on professional disclosure statement for?
Information such as education, licenses, certifications, work experience, fees, and any potential conflicts of interest must be reported on the professional disclosure statement.
